The funds in the account are owned and controlled by one person.
Single Party
Funds are owned and controlled by one person, and the owner elects to have a beneficiary(ies) named in event of death.
Single Party with Payable on Death (POD)
Account is owned by two or more owners with funds going to the surviving owner in the event of a death.
Multiple Party with Survivorship (MPWROS)
Account owned by two or more owners and has a beneficiary(ies) named
Multiple Party with Survivorship and Payable on Death (MPWROS & POD)
Account with two or more owners where funds are divided according to each party’s contribution upon event of death.
Multiple Party without Survivorship (MPWOROS)
